tristimulus

adjective

tri·​stim·​u·​lus (ˌ)trī-ˈstim-yə-ləs How to pronounce tristimulus (audio)
: of or relating to values giving the amounts of the three colored lights red, green, and blue that when combined additively produce a match for the color being considered
